웹 개발
shadcn/ui + Radix UI: 헤드리스 컴포넌트 전략과 커스터마이징
shadcn/ui를 사용하는 이유와 Radix UI 헤드리스 컴포넌트 원리, 디자인 토큰 연동, 커스텀 컴포넌트 추가, 접근성 내장 다이얼로그·드롭다운·선택 컴포넌트 구현 패턴을 다룹니다.
shadcn/uiRadix UI헤드리스 컴포넌트디자인 시스템React
주제별로 묶은 프론트엔드·웹 플랫폼 블로그 글입니다. 카테고리별 열람이 가능합니다.
웹 개발 · 4건
웹 개발
shadcn/ui를 사용하는 이유와 Radix UI 헤드리스 컴포넌트 원리, 디자인 토큰 연동, 커스텀 컴포넌트 추가, 접근성 내장 다이얼로그·드롭다운·선택 컴포넌트 구현 패턴을 다룹니다.
웹 개발
ARIA Live Regions(aria-live, role=alert, role=status)로 동적 콘텐츠 변경을 스크린 리더에 알리는 방법, 알림 토스트·폼 유효성·로딩 상태 접근성 구현 패턴을 다룹니다.
웹 개발
TanStack Query v5의 변경된 API(useQuery 옵션 통합), 낙관적 업데이트, 무한 스크롤, 의존 쿼리, 백그라운드 리패칭, Suspense 모드, React Server Components 통합을 다룹니다.
웹 개발
Vite 6와 Turbopack(Next.js 15 기본)의 HMR 속도, 프로덕션 빌드 성능, 플러그인 생태계, 설정 복잡도를 실제 벤치마크와 함께 비교하고 프로젝트 유형별 선택 기준을 다룹니다.